Plano-Convex Lenses are Optical Lenses with a positive focal length. Plano-Convex Lenses are ideal for light collimation or for focusing applications utilizing monochromatic illumination, in a range of industries including industrial, pharmaceutical, robotics, or defense. PCX Lenses have one convex surface. For maximum efficiency, the second, plano (flat) surface should face the desired focal plane. Plano-Convex lenses are commonly used in a wide range of applications or industries.
